Everybody knows that it is dangerous to drive at night. From poor visibility to natural fatigue, it can be a dangerous experience to drive down the road after dark. If you haven’t replaced your headlight covers in a while, they may have begun to yellow and discolor. Discolored headlights can lower your visibility, thus increasing your exposure to potential danger.

If you want to get your headlights back to their brightest, consider applying a layer of Crest toothpaste to your plastic headlight covers. Polish the toothpaste before wiping it away with a rag to reveal the sparkling surface underneath.



How Do I Clean Headlights Using Toothpaste?

To clean your headlights using toothpaste, follow these steps:

  1. Spray glass cleaner or warm soapy water on the headlights
  2. Use a microfiber cloth to clean any excess dust, dirt and other grime from the headlights
  3. Get a soft lint-free absorbent towel and use it to dry them. Using a lint-free towel ensures you don’t leave small fibers behind that could get stuck in the crevices, while being soft ensures you don’t create small scratches on the surface
  4. Tape around the headlights so you don’t touch the paint when cleaning
  5. Squeeze a small bit of toothpaste onto a sponge, cloth or directly onto the headlights
  6. Polish the headlights using a microfiber cloth or sponge by spreading the toothpaste outwards in circles, and repeat this until the whole surface of each headlight is covered
  7. If the headlights don’t clear up after your first few rounds, add some more toothpaste. You could also switch to a toothbrush with soft bristles so you can scrub harder
  8. When they look clear enough, rinse them off with warm water. Keep rinsing until the water runs clear to know you’ve gotten everything out
  9. Remove the tape gently so you don’t ruin your paint or leave any adhesive behind
